Copy Class
Explanation
This activity allows you to copy class data, relations and properties from an 
existing class, the source class, to a new class, the target class. It is 
possible to define if class data, relations and properties from the source class 
should be copied to the target class.
Prerequisites
A Standard and Class should exist.
System Effects
A new target class will be created and annexed to the target standard along 
with class data, relations and properties, if defined.

Procedure
Using the Class or Classes window:
	- Open the Class or Classes window. 
- Search for the class from which you want to copy data. This will be the 
	Source Class.
- Right-click on the class and click Copy Class. The Copy 
	Class dialog box opens with values automatically set for the Source
	Standard and Class fields.  
- In the Standard field for the Target group of fields, use the 
	List of Values to select an existing standard for which you want to annex 
	the new target class.
- In the Class field for the Target group of fields, enter a name 
	for the class that you want to create for the defined standard. 
- Clear the Class Data check box, if you do not want the target 
	class to inherit class data from the source class.
- Clear the Class Relations check box, if you do not want the target 
	class to inherit class relations from the source class.
- Clear the Class Properties check box, if you do not want the 
	target class to inherit class properties from the source class. 
- Click Copy.
